NOK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2024 in Review
440 of the 6,958 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Nokia (NOK) for Q1 2024, worth a combined $1.2B — up 17% from $1.03B a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 60 funds closed out of NOK and 54 opened new positions — a net loss of 6 holders — while 120 trimmed existing stakes and 139 added.
The largest buyer was Slate Path Capital, opening a new position worth an estimated $113M. The largest seller was Capital International Investors, exiting entirely with an estimated $27.9M sold.
